  1. Telemedicine and Virtual Care
    It has become an essential part of healthcare delivery, especially since the pandemic. Today, top healthcare speakers continue to emphasize the growing importance of virtual consultations, remote monitoring, and digital health platforms. Consultants are discussing how telemedicine improves access to care, particularly in underserved or rural areas, and helps reduce patient wait times. Keynote advisors also highlight the benefits of virtual care in managing chronic conditions, where continuous monitoring and regular check-ups are crucial for patients’ well-being.
  2. AI and Machine Learning in Diagnostics
    The rise of artificial intelligence (AI) is transforming the way that medical providers diagnose and treat patients. Celebrity healthcare speakers are focusing on how AI and machine learning are being used to analyze medical data, predict disease patterns, and support decision-making. From reading medical imaging to predicting patient outcomes, AI is increasing diagnostic accuracy and helping doctors make faster, more informed decisions. The trend also extends to personalized medicine, where AI analyzes patient data to tailor treatments that are specific to their individual needs.

  4. Wearables and Health Monitoring
    Also note that wearable devices such as smartwatches and fitness trackers, are growing in popularity and offering real-time health monitoring capabilities. Healthcare speakers are discussing the role of wearables in preventative care, allowing individuals to track their vitals, activity levels, and sleep patterns. The devices are providing valuable data for both patients and healthcare providers, making it easier to detect early signs of health issues and intervene before conditions worsen. Keynote providers also highlight how wearables contribute to personalized health management and greater patient autonomy.
